[hide]Description
The Satellite Dish is used together with a Computer fitted with a Motherboard (Communications) to allow Interstellar Communications.
The Satellite Dish must be guided by Satellite Tracking onto a signal and communications may be established once the signal strength is greater than 94%
Medium Satellite Dish
After "Big Changes Coming: Terrain Preview, Melting Ice, Modding, & Localization" update, Medium Satellite Dish has internal stack like Autolathe, which user can utilize it to give instructions to. The Medium Satellite Dish currently have 256Bytes(32 Addresses) stack memory.
Op_code | Name | Description | Valid Address | Bits | Bits Description |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
1 | TraderInstruction.WriteTraderData | The dish will write out metadata(24 Bytes, in continuous of 3 addresses) to the specified starting index. E.g.: if set WRITE_INDEX to 1, then the metadata will span address 1-3. See Metadata Payloads. | 0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| WRITE_INDEX | ||||
16-63 | Unused | ||||
2 | TraderInstruction.StrongestContactIdHash | This OpCode indicates the data generated by TraderInstruction.WriteTraderData payload segment 1. | 0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-39 | TRADER_ID_HASH | ||||
40-63 | Unused | ||||
3 | TraderInstruction.StrongestContactMetaData | This OpCode indicates the data generated by TraderInstruction.WriteTraderData payload segment 2. | 0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| SHUTTLE_TYPE. | ||||
16-23 | CONTACT_TIER. | ||||
24-31 | CONTACTED. | ||||
32-63 | Unused | ||||
4 | TraderInstruction.StrongestContactSignalData | This OpCode indicates the data generated by TraderInstruction.WriteTraderData payload segment 3. | 0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-23 | WATTS_TO_RESOLVE See WattsToResolve. | ||||
24-39 | LIFETIME See LifeTime. | ||||
32-63 | Unused | ||||
5 | TraderInstruction.WriteTraderBuyData | The dish will write out trader buy metadatas from the starting address WRITE_INDEX, and write WRITE_COUNT continuous addresses total. If an item contains child items, then it will be expaned inplace. E.g.: <BuyPayload><BuyPayload><BuyChildPayload><BuyPayload>. See Buy/Sell Payloads, Buy/Sell Child Payloads. |
0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| WRITE_INDEX | ||||
16-23 | WRITE_COUNT | ||||
24-63 | Unused | ||||
6 | TraderInstruction.WriteTraderSellData | The dish will write out trader sell metadatas from the starting address WRITE_INDEX, and write WRITE_COUNT continuous addresses total. If an item contains child items, then it will be expaned inplace. E.g.: <SellPayload><SellPayload><SellChildPayload><SellPayload>. See Buy/Sell Payloads, Buy/Sell Child Payloads. |
0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| WRITE_INDEX | ||||
16-23 | WRITE_COUNT | ||||
24-63 | Unused | ||||
7 | TraderInstruction.TraderBuyThingData | This OpCode indicates the data generated by TraderInstruction.WriteTraderBuyData. | 0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| QUANTITY | ||||
16-47 | PREFAB_HASH | ||||
48-63 | Unused | ||||
8 | TraderInstruction.TraderBuyThingChildData | This OpCode indicates the data generated by TraderInstruction.WriteTraderBuyData. | 0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| QUANTITY | ||||
16-47 | PREFAB_HASH | ||||
48-63 | Unused | ||||
9 | TraderInstruction.TraderBuyGasData | This OpCode indicates the data generated by TraderInstruction.WriteTraderBuyData. | 0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| QUANTITY | ||||
16-47 | GAS_TYPES_BITFLAG See Gas_Type_BitFlags. | ||||
48-63 | Unused | ||||
10 | TraderInstruction.TraderSellThingData | This OpCode indicates the data generated by TraderInstruction.WriteTraderSellData. | 0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| QUANTITY | ||||
16-47 | PREFAB_HASH | ||||
48-63 | Unused | ||||
11 | TraderInstruction.TraderSellGasData | This OpCode indicates the data generated by TraderInstruction.WriteTraderSellData. | 0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| QUANTITY | ||||
16-47 | GAS_TYPES_BIGFLAG See Gas_Type_BitFlags. | ||||
48-63 | Unused | ||||
12 | TraderInstruction.TraderSellThingChildData | This OpCode indicates the data generated by TraderInstruction.WriteTraderSellData. | 0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| QUANTITY | ||||
16-47 | PREFAB_HASH | ||||
48-63 | Unused | ||||
13 | TraderInstruction.FilterPrefabHashEquals | Filter Operation. User can append this OP after any TraderInstruction.Write* OP to filter writer's output. This OP's effective scope is the last Write* OP and before the next Write* OP. Multple filter OP can be written to the addresses after a Write* OP to group as a "AND" condition. This Filter narrows Write* OP's output to only matching PrefabHash. |
0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-39 | PREFAB_HASH | ||||
40-63 | Unused | ||||
14 | TraderInstruction.FilterPrefabHashNotEquals | Filter Operation. User can append this OP after any TraderInstruction.Write* OP to filter writer's output. This OP's effective scope is the last Write* OP and before the next Write* OP. Multple filter OP can be written to the addresses after a Write* OP to group as a "AND" condition. This Filter narrows Write* OP's output to only not matching PrefabHash. |
0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-39 | PREFAB_HASH | ||||
40-63 | Unused | ||||
15 | TraderInstruction.FilterSortingClassCompare | Filter Operation. User can append this OP after any TraderInstruction.Write* OP to filter writer's output. This OP's effective scope is the last Write* OP and before the next Write* OP. Multple filter OP can be written to the addresses after a Write* OP to group as a "AND" condition. This Filter narrows Write* OP's output to only matching SortingClass. |
0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| CONDITION_OPERATION 0: Equals 1: Greater 2: Less 3: Not Equals | ||||
16-31 | SORTING_CLASS See Sorting_Class. | ||||
32-63 | Unused | ||||
16 | TraderInstruction.FilterQuantityCompare | Filter Operation. User can append this OP after any TraderInstruction.Write* OP to filter writer's output. This OP's effective scope is the last Write* OP and before the next Write* OP. Multple filter OP can be written to the addresses after a Write* OP to group as a "AND" condition. This Filter narrows Write* OP's output to only matching Quantity Condition. |
0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-15 | CONDITION_OPERATION 0: Equals 1: Greater 2: Less 3: Not Equals | ||||
16-31 | QUANTITY | ||||
32-63 | Unused | ||||
17 | TraderInstruction.FilterGasContains | Filter Operation. User can append this OP after any TraderInstruction.Write* OP to filter writer's output. This OP's effective scope is the last Write* OP and before the next Write* OP. Multple filter OP can be written to the addresses after a Write* OP to group as a "AND" condition. This Filter narrows Write* OP's output to only matching Gases. |
0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-39 | GAS_TYPES_BITFLAG See Gas_Type_BitFlags. | ||||
40-63 | Unused | ||||
18 | TraderInstruction.FilterGasNotContains | Filter Operation. User can append this OP after any TraderInstruction.Write* OP to filter writer's output. This OP's effective scope is the last Write* OP and before the next Write* OP. Multple filter OP can be written to the addresses after a Write* OP to group as a "AND" condition. This Filter narrows Write* OP's output to only not matching Gases. |
0-31 | 0-7 | Op_code |
8-39 | GAS_TYPES_BITFLAG See Gas_Type_BitFlags. | ||||
40-63 | Unused |
Metadata Payloads
Since Metadata has 3 addresses, so it's referenced here as a 24 bytes(192 bits) payload.
BitsOffset | 191-168 | 167-136 | 135-128 | 127-96 | 95-88 | 87-80 | 79-72 | 71-64 | 63-40 | 39-16 | 15-8 | 7-0 |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Contents | N/A | ContactTypeID | OpCode of TraderInstruction.StrongestContactIdHash. | N/A | Contacted 0: false 1: true |
Contact Tier: 0: Close 1: Medium 2: Far |
Shuttle Type: 0:None 1: Small(3x3) 2: SmallGas(3x3) 3: Medium(5x5) 4: MediumGas(5x5) 5: Large(6x6) 6: LargeGas(6x6) 7: MediumPlane(7x7, runway:15) 8: LargePlane(9x9, runway:20) |
OpCode of TraderInstruction.StrongestContactMetaData. | N/A | LifeTime | WattsToResolve | OpCode of TraderInstruction.StrongestContactSignalData. |
Buy/Sell Payloads
Buy/Sell Payloads are 1 address each, so it's referenced here as a 8 bytes(64 bit) payload.
BitsOffset | 63-48 | 47-16 | 15-8 | 7-0 |
---|---|---|---|---|
Contents | N/A | PrefabHash/GasTypeBitFlag | Quantity This value is truncated so it won't be greater than 255 although the trader's Request/Stock is more than 255. |
OpCode Which OpCode requested this data. |
Buy/Sell Child Payloads
Buy/Sell Payloads are 1 address each, so it's referenced here as a 8 bytes(64 bit) payload.
BitsOffset | 63-48 | 47-16 | 15-8 | 7-0 |
---|---|---|---|---|
Contents | N/A | PrefabHash/GasTypeBitFlag | ChildCount Counts how many instances of this item appeared as a child item. Beware it's not quantity, it's just a prefab type count. |
OpCode If this data is requested by TraderInstruction.WriteTraderBuyData, then it's value is the OpCode of TraderInstruction.TraderBuyThingChildData. If this data is requested by TraderInstruction.WriteTraderSellData, then it's value is the OpCode of TraderInstruction.TraderSellThingChildData. |
Gas Type BitFlags
If the BitFlag equals 0, it's undefined. If the bit at specific offset is 1, it means the gas contains that component.
BitsOffset | 16 | 15 | 14 | 13 | 12 | 11 | 10 | 9 | 8 | 7 | 6 | 5 | 4 | 3 | 2 | 1 | 0 |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Contents | PollutedWater | LiquidHydrogen | Hydrogen | LiquidNitrousOxide | LiquidPollutant | LiquidCarbonDioxide | Steam | LiquidVolatiles | LiquidOxygen | LiquidNitrogen | NitrousOxide | Water | Pollutant | Volatiles | CarbonDioxide | Nitrogen | Oxygen |
Special Gas:
- Bit 0,1 both set to 1, which is Air.
- Bit 0,3 both set to 1, which is Fuel.
